发明名称 OPTIMIZATION APPARATUS FOR PROGRAM, OPTIMIZATION METHOD AND OPTIMIZATION PROGRAM
摘要 <P>PROBLEM TO BE SOLVED: To provide an apparatus and method in which a binary string composed of a plurality of instructions including a function call can be dynamically rewritten. <P>SOLUTION: An apparatus is provided which includes a transactional memory that enables exclusive control of a transaction. The apparatus comprises a first code generator 200 which interprets a program and generates a first code in which a starting instruction to start a transaction and an ending instruction to end the transaction are inserted before and after an instruction string composed of a plurality of instructions for executing designated processing in the program, a second code generator 201 which generates a second code using a plurality of instructions in predetermined timing in response to the designated processing, and a code writer 202 which overwrites an instruction string of the first code with the second code or writes the second code into a part of the first code, within the transaction. <P>COPYRIGHT: (C)2012,JPO&INPIT
申请公布号 JP2012128628(A) 申请公布日期 2012.07.05
申请号 JP20100279022 申请日期 2010.12.15
申请人 INTERNATL BUSINESS MACH CORP <IBM> 发明人 NAKAIKE TAKUYA
分类号 G06F9/45 主分类号 G06F9/45
代理机构 代理人
主权项
地址